i have a 1996 Ranger 4.0 4x4 , i was wonderin what the max tire size i could run on a stock drivetrain , it has an 8.8 Rear with 3.73 gears and a factory l/s , i had 31's on it at one time , i was wonderin if i could go up to 32's , they would be on American Racing AR23 15x8 rims that have a -19mm offset , the tires are cooper discoverer stt's , any input is greatly appreciated
 
check here for you best fitment, however looking it over it seems you would need either a body or suspension lift. Myabe someone else can give you more info though.
 
i have a 93 and 96's are pretty much the same body style and the biggest i can fit stock with no rubbing is a 31x10.50...
